Output 26a66245c53b93567d14f2b87a62759b96bf4e19b350b0bd2e6acd3842431182:2

value
157070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8404a58879361ef1bd7e0a95c3e9c50b4f583e95 OP_EQUAL
address
3Dj4giakhvnYGKubGurbNeFUgrBB2e9vCh
transaction
26a66245c53b93567d14f2b87a62759b96bf4e19b350b0bd2e6acd3842431182
spent
true